BUFFALO, N.Y. - The Seton Hall volleyball team dropped its season opener to Fordham, 3-0 (25-14, 13-25, 23-25), to begin the University at Buffalo Tournament on Friday. The Pirates will continue play at the tournament on Saturday, August 29 against Boston College at 10:30 a.m. before playing Buffalo at 7:00 p.m.
Senior Allie Matters (North Tonowanda, N.Y.) led all players with 13 digs on the day. Sophomore Meghan Matusiak (Winfield, Ill.) led the offense with six kills. The Rams (1-0) boasted a .319 attack percentage, and were led by Kailee May who had 14 kills at a .423 clip.
After a back-and-forth start in set one, the Rams went on an 8-1 spurt to hold a 12-6 lead and forced SHU to call a timeout. Fordham pushed the margin to 20-10 and took the opening frame, by a 25-14 score.
Seton Hall fell behind by 8-2 early in the second set and the Rams never looked back once again, taking the game, 25-13.
The teams went toe-to-toe in the third set with neither team leading by more than three points. With the score knotted at 23-23, a consecutive kills by Christine Griffiths gave Fordham the final two points of the match and preserved the win.
